Social and Community Service Managers Salary in Oklahoma
The median pay for a social and community service managers in Oklahoma is $65,010/year ($31.25/hour), per BLS data. The range runs from $37K at the entry level to $106K for experienced workers.

Annual earnings by percentile, Oklahoma
Entry-level social and community service managers (10th percentile) start around $37K. Mid-career wages sit at $65K.Top earners bring in $106K or more - a $69K spread from bottom to top.

How much do social and community service managers make in Oklahoma?
The median is $65,010 a year - that works out to about $31.25 an hour. The range is wide: entry-level workers start around $37,370, and experienced social and community service managers can clear $106,120. These are BLS numbers, based on employer-reported data, not self-reported surveys.
Is $65K enough to live in Oklahoma?
On that salary, you'd take home roughly $4,294/month after taxes. A 2-bedroom in this state rents for about $1,217/month (median of metro areas), which eats 28.3% of your paycheck. That's under the 30% guideline most financial planners use, so the numbers work.
How far does a social and community service managers salary go in Oklahoma?
Oklahoma has a Regional Price Parity of 100 (100 is the national average). That's right at the national average. After cost-of-living adjustment, the median social and community service managers salary is worth about $65,010 in national-average purchasing power.
